Password
Password protection prevents unauthorized users from changing programming information . Initially the password is set to all
zeros . Its displayed name is PASSWORD and is viewed or changed using the Numeric Value Entry Procedure .
Restore Defaults
This feature allows you to restore factory calibration data . Its displayed name is RES DFLT . To restore factory calibration data,
select YES, then press ENTER .
Advanced Programming Descriptions
Advanced programming allows the user access to re-configure the analog output . Calibration of the analog output is preset
at the factory, but can be changed to customize calibration for your installation .
To access the Advanced Programming Options, press and hold MENU for approximately 3 seconds until DISPLAY is viewed on
the display panel . The programming menus will begin with display mode DISPLAY and continue as described above through
output mode OUT MODE .
After output mode has been entered, Advanced Programming starts with the following:
Calibration of Analog Output
This selection allows access to the calibration and testing of the analog output signal .
To test or change the analog output calibration, it is first necessary to change the default setting for CAL OUT? from NO to YES .

Setup prompts and descriptors for configuring and calibrating the analog output will correspond to the output
mode selected . Refer to the Flow Chart .
1 . At the CAL OUT? prompt press ENTER . NO will display .
2 . To change to YES, press either arrow key .
3 . The analog output will go to its minimum output level . A numeric value between 0-4000 will display . This is an internal
number used to drive the analog output .
4 . To increase the analog output signal level, press
. To decrease the analog output signal level, press
.
5 . Press ENTER to store the setting .
6 . The analog output will go to its maximum output level . A numeric value between 0-4000 will display . This is an internal
number used to drive the analog output .
7 . To increase the analog output signal level, press
. To decrease the analog output signal level, press
.
8 . Press ENTER to store the setting .
9 . The unit will advance to the analog output test mode . The analog output will go to its minimum output level . A numeric
value of 0 will display . For test purposes, the analog output signal can be run up or down in increments of 1 milliamp or 1
volt, depending on the OUT MODE selected .
10 . To increase the analog output signal level, press
. To decrease the analog output signal level, press
.
11 . Press ENTER to exit the analog calibration mode .
12 . The unit automatically advances to the PASSWORD feature .
